Output e4b2c2fd4e7dbfd87d3c5d3db30d00b88da364db7094c532d68ce485ece17a96:6

value
42638629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ffc1e5ae4f0d5c33602d3a929cf8c69a01302f0 OP_EQUAL
address
3GGwPYsx4m8QEen3XFyJ4sVs1J7jPycbjx
transaction
e4b2c2fd4e7dbfd87d3c5d3db30d00b88da364db7094c532d68ce485ece17a96
confirmations
55790
spent
false